Boston Public Schools Students Getting No Formal Instruction During Coronavirus Emergency; Teachers Still Getting Paid

Public school classes have not taken place in Boston since Monday, March 16 because of the coronavirus pandemic. So far, neither have any formal online classes for the district's more than 54,000 students.

Even so, teachers are still being paid as usual.

Massachusetts Men Arrested For Golfing In Rhode Island

Matthew McDonald

Unlike Massachusetts, golfing is still allowed in Rhode Island for the time being — but only if you're from Rhode Island.

Three Massachusetts residents snuck in a round of golf at Meadow Brook Golf Course in Rhode Island last week, as The Washington Examiner reports, and it did not end up going well for them.
